Proportion of urban population living in slums in Colombia
Colombia: Proportion of urban population living in slums was 9.7% in 2024. ▼ Falling
Proportion of urban population living in slums in Colombia, 2000–2024
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database.
Analysis
Colombia recorded 9.7% for proportion of urban population living in slums in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 13 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 17.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, proportion of urban population living in slums in Colombia peaked at 21.2%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 9.7%, in 2018.
That places Colombia 83rd out of 182 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 13 years of available data.
Proportion of urban population living in slums in Colombia,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 21.2% | — |
| 2002 | 19.8% | -6.4% |
| 2004 | 18.5% | -6.8% |
| 2006 | 17.1% | -7.3% |
| 2008 | 15.8% | -7.8% |
| 2010 | 14.4% | -8.5% |
| 2012 | 13.1% | -9.3% |
| 2014 | 11.8% | -10.2% |
| 2016 | 10.4% | -11.5% |
| 2018 | 9.7% | -6.9% |
| 2020 | 9.7% | +0.0% |
| 2022 | 9.7% | +0.0% |
| 2024 | 9.7% | +0.0% |
